The continued occurrence of sickle-cell disease in parts of Africa with malaria is due to fitness of the heterozygote.

Explanation:

The continued occurrence of sickle-cell disease in parts of Africa with malaria is due to the heterozygous individuals having a selective advantage. Heterozygotes carry one normal hemoglobin allele and one sickle-cell allele, which confer resistance to malaria without the severe effects of sickle-cell disease. This heterozygote advantage maintains the sickle-cell allele in populations where malaria is common.
